Why does the presidential election matter to the future of the court?
Marizza181 [45]

Answer:

Presidential eletions have a huge impact on the future court. The president appoints justices to the court. As a result if any justice retires ,or passess away his seat on the court will be appointed by the sitting president. If the retiring justices is republican and the Demoncrates win the election the president will appoint someone to the seat who believes in the way he or she does. This can result in an unequal number of justices that believe and or support one political party over the other.

What were the effects of the slave resistances
ozzi

Answer:

On the plantations, resistance reduced profitability. Enslaved Africans tried to slow down the pace of work through pretending illness or breaking tools and they ran away whenever possible, escaping to South America, England or North America.

Explanation:

"Day-to-day resistance" was the most common form of opposition to slavery. Breaking tools, feigning illness, staging slowdowns, and committing acts of arson and sabotage--all were forms of resistance and expression of slaves' alienation from their masters. Running away was another form of resistance.
